CHEM Middle East 2006 exhibition is launched
- United Arab Emirates: Sunday, February 12 - 2006 at 16:47
- PRESS RELEASE
Abdurrahman G. Al Mutaiwee the Director General of Dubai Chamber of Commerce and industry DCCI launched CHEM Middle East 2006 Exhibition
CHEM Middle East 2006 Exhibition is dedicated to the chemical, petrochemical, chemical process technology, corrosion-control and management industries. The Exhibition's main highlight is the comprehensive display of cutting-edge products, technologies and services related to the industries & since its inception,
The exhibition is expected to attract leaders, industrial managers, professionals, technocrats, consultants, government officials, distributors, agents, buyers' delegations and others associated with these industries on a single platform.
Al Mutaiwee met the exhibitors and listened to their explanation about their products and services. He expressed his satisfaction on the level of the participants companies and the demonstrated products.
CHEM Middle East 2006 is supported by DCCI. The exhibition attracted About 40 exhibitors from 12 countries include the United Arab Emirates, China, Germany, UK, Italy, Russia, Bulgaria, Hong Kong and India.
